## Action item: AddressPilot autocomplete (Owner: Tems)

During the Brindlemoor outage, the autocomplete widget hammered the geocoder because debounce and retry settings were too aggressive, amplifying the backend failure. Fix: move all timing knobs out of the widget bundle into a shared config module so ops can tune without a redeploy. New contractor: start by extracting the values, keeping current behavior identical. The constants to extract are listed below.

constants for tageg-kagag:
QUOTAS = {
    "kelax": 495,
    "istath": 366,
    "tammir": 108,
    "novdor": 730,
    "casax": 816,
    "quenael": 874,
    "pelius": 403,
}

Prepared for the incoming director. Eastvale revenue rose four percent quarter on quarter, driven chiefly by the Merrow product family, while margins slipped slightly due to promotional spend in the Ashfort territory. Receivables ageing improved; two large accounts remain under watch. Cost discipline at the Dunley branch was notably strong and merits recognition. Full workings are attached for your review ahead of the planning session. The confidential note on forward business plans appears directly below.

confidential, kagup-bafog: Fraaxax Group is in early talks to buy Soroxox Group for about $343.8 million. The Olidor launch date is June 14, and nothing goes to the press before then. Legal wants the Aldmirek Logistics term sheet signed before July 23.

## Splitwire Assignment Service — Support Onboarding

Splitwire decides which experiment bucket each visitor lands in. When a customer reports inconsistent variants, first check whether their session token was regenerated mid-experiment — that's the most common cause. Escalations involving assignment hashes go to the Meridian Labs platform rotation. For verifying that a customer's SDK build is genuine before debugging further, compare its signature against the official release key shown below.

rollout seal: bky4_x7Gc